Vegetarian Hall of Fame - The Vegetarian Hall of Fame is an award presented by the North American Vegetarian Society (NAVS), in recognition of individuals who have made significant contributions to the vegetarian movement. The award is usually presented at the annual NAVS Summerfest. The Pitman Vegetarian Hotel - The Pitman Vegetarian Hotel was a vegetarian hotel that opened in 1898 in Birmingham, England, as an expansion of a vegetarian restaurant on the same site. The manager was James Henry Cook. International Vegetarian Union - The International Vegetarian Union (IVU) was founded in 1908 when the first World Vegetarian Congress was held in Dresden, Germany. The idea for IVU came from the French Vegetarian Society, the first Congress was organised internationally by the British Society and locally by the Dresden Society with support from the Deutsche Vegetarier-Bund. Vegetarian Society - The Vegetarian Society is a British society founded 30 September 1847 and is believed to be the oldest society promoting vegetarianism in the world. The first meeting was held at Northwood Villa, a vegetarian hospital at Ramsgate in Kent.
